A study of 114 patients with primary head and neck cancers found that photodynamic therapy achieved an overall response rate of 91% after two years, with 85% showing complete tumor elimination. The treatment also produced high one- and two-year overall survival rates of 90% and 81%, respectively.
Professor Julian Peto warns that current data protection legislation is hindering cancer research by withholding medical records and tissue samples. Researchers face obstacles in tracking disease development and identifying genetic factors due to lack of access to historical data.
European cancer specialists expect an overview of anti-oestrogen drug trials by 2005, allowing evaluation of long-term effects on breast cancer incidence and mortality. The US FDA has approved tamoxifen for high-risk women, but European experts are cautious due to differing trial results.
The US cancer community must adopt a new paradigm to develop and test cancer treatments, says Dr Edison Liu. The shift in emphasis is needed due to rapid advancements in biological technology, which could lead to significant improvements in prevention, diagnosis, and treatment.
The ECCO organisation urges a streamlined process for new cancer drugs, citing long and cumbersome procedures that hinder patient access. Experts warn of the need for harmonisation between regulatory agencies to avoid duplication and shorten the approval process.
Lymphoedema is a chronic condition resulting from breast cancer surgery and radiotherapy, characterized by swelling, pain, and disability. Early diagnosis and proper treatment can help alleviate symptoms, but increased awareness and education for healthcare professionals are crucial to prevent disastrous consequences.
A novel liposuction treatment has been developed to treat chronic lymphoedema in breast cancer patients, reducing arm swelling by up to 98% and improving mobility and pain levels. The treatment involves removing fatty tissue and accumulated lymph via small incisions along the arm.
Researchers predict personalized breast cancer treatments using genetic profiles, with potential annual reduction of recurrence risks. Up to 100,000 genes in each cell are being studied for predictive value, leading to a future of tailored therapies.
The year 2000 marks a significant turning point in cancer research, driven by advances in genetic knowledge and increased international cooperation. This collaboration enables large-scale trials to be conducted more quickly, leading to potential breakthroughs in cancer prevention and treatment.
Adjuvant treatments with radiotherapy, chemotherapy, and hormone treatment tamoxifen can prevent late recurrences in breast cancer patients. The new findings show a significant decrease in deaths from breast cancer in middle-aged women, with a 30% fall over the past decade in the UK.
A major international trial found that giving extra radiotherapy to patients with early breast cancer substantially reduces the risk of cancer recurring in the breast. The study, involving 5,569 patients from nine countries, showed a significant benefit in younger women, particularly those under 40.
